zeplin-extension-style-kit
Version:
Models and utilities to generate CSS-like style code in Zeplin extensions.
54 lines (53 loc) • 1.61 kB
JavaScript
Object.defineProperty(exports, "__esModule", {
value: true
});
exports.STYLE_PROPS = exports.OPTION_NAMES = void 0;
var STYLE_PROPS = {
FONT_FAMILY: "font-family",
FONT_SIZE: "font-size",
FONT_WEIGHT: "font-weight",
FONT_STYLE: "font-style",
FONT_STRETCH: "font-stretch",
FONT_VARIATION_SETTINGS: "font-variation-settings",
FONT_SRC: "src",
LINE_HEIGHT: "line-height",
LETTER_SPACING: "letter-spacing",
TEXT_ALIGN: "text-align",
COLOR: "color",
WIDTH: "width",
HEIGHT: "height",
OBJECT_FIT: "object-fit",
TRANSFORM: "transform",
OPACITY: "opacity",
BLEND_MODE: "mix-blend-mode",
BORDER_RADIUS: "border-radius",
BACKGROUND_BLEND_MODE: "background-blend-mode",
BACKGROUND_IMAGE: "background-image",
BACKGROUND_COLOR: "background-color",
TEXT_SHADOW: "text-shadow",
BOX_SHADOW: "box-shadow",
BORDER: "border",
BACKGROUND_ORIGIN: "background-origin",
BACKGROUND_CLIP: "background-clip",
TEXT_STROKE: "text-stroke",
BORDER_STYLE: "border-style",
BORDER_WIDTH: "border-width",
BORDER_IMAGE_SOURCE: "border-image-source",
BORDER_IMAGE_SLICE: "border-image-slice",
BACKDROP_FILTER: "backdrop-filter",
FILTER: "filter",
TEXT_FILL_COLOR: "text-fill-color",
FONT_COLOR: "color"
};
exports.STYLE_PROPS = STYLE_PROPS;
var OPTION_NAMES = {
USE_LINKED_STYLEGUIDES: "useLinkedStyleguides",
COLOR_FORMAT: "colorFormat",
SHOW_DEFAULT_VALUES: "showDefaultValues",
SHOW_DIMENSIONS: "showDimensions",
UNITLESS_LINE_HEIGHT: "unitlessLineHeight",
MIXIN: "mixin",
USE_REM_UNIT: "useRemUnit"
};
exports.OPTION_NAMES = OPTION_NAMES;
;